Sustainability of horse-drawn carriages as tourist attractions, case studies of select Philippine cities

    Abstract:
    This master’s thesis explores the sustainability of horse-drawn carriages called the “calesa” as tourist attractions in the selected cities in the Philippines. While several destinations around the world have banned horse-drawn carriages as attractions, the study investigates why the calesa in the Philippines, a horse-drawn carriage introduced during the Spanish Colonial Rule in the country, survives as a contemporary tourist attraction in some cities in the Philippines namely the City of San Fernando (Pampanga), Municipality of Cabagan (Isabela), Tuguegarao City (Cagayan), Laoag City (Ilocos Norte), and Vigan City (Ilocos Sur).
